Weather in May/June
Photo by Kian Philippe Martos
May and June are great months to visit Manila, as the weather is warm and sunny, but not too hot. The average temperature during these months is around 30°C (86°F), with plenty of sunshine and clear blue skies. The humidity can be high, so be sure to stay hydrated and take breaks in the air-conditioned indoors if needed.

Cost of Travel
Photo by Ferdie Balean
The cost of travel to Manila will vary depending on where you’re coming from and how you choose to get there. Flights to Manila start at around $700 from major cities in the US, while local transportation is inexpensive and easy to navigate. Accommodations and meals are also relatively inexpensive, making Manila a budget-friendly destination.
